Understanding the Evolution of Slot Games: From Spin to Strategy

Historically, slots were straightforward: a random number generator (RNG), a few symbols, and the promise of instant gratification. However, the market’s maturation prompted developers to incorporate themes, bonus rounds, and progressive jackpots, aiming to create immersive narratives and longer play cycles. Today, analytical insights reveal that modern players value interactivity and strategic elements as much as traditional chance-based outcomes.

Introducing ‘Drop the Boss’: A Paradigm Shift in Slot Mechanics

The “Drop the Boss” mechanic breaks conventional boundaries by integrating real-time battle elements, role-based themes, and decision-driven gameplay within traditional slot frameworks. Its core innovation lies in combining luck with user agency—players can influence game states through strategic choices, such as deploying power-ups or attacking bosses, to unlock multipliers, free spins, or bonus multipliers.

Exemplar Feature: In “Drop the Boss” themed slots, a boss character appears periodically, and players can opt to engage or avoid combat, each choice impacting the reward structure. This mechanic creates a layered experience that increases player investment and satisfaction.
